Headnotes / Summary

S.32

Constitution of Pakistan (1973), Art. 199

Constitutional petition

Admission in B.A. class in Baha-ud-Din Zakaria (BZ) University

Students having two years post matric diploma of Field Assistant from Pak German Poly Technic Institute of Cooperative Agriculture, Multan affiliated with University of Agriculture, Faisalabad

Disallowing admission to such students by BZ University

Validity

According to Rules of Inter Board Coordination Committee (IBCC), such diploma Field Assistant awarded by University of Agricultural, Faisalabad or any of its affiliated Institute would be equivalent to Higher Secondary School Certificate (Agricultural Group) subject to passing English, Urdu and Pakistan Studies at Higher Secondary School Certificate level from any Board of Intermediate and Secondary Education in Pakistan or Allama Iqbal Open University

Impugned decision of BZ University was in accordance with policy of IBCC

High Court dismissed constitutional petition in circumstances.

Judgment & Decree

KHALIL AHMAD, J.

Petitioner is Project Manager of Pak German Poly Technic Institute of Cooperative Agriculture, Multan. He has filed this petition alleging that the students who have passed Field Assistant two years course from their institute is equated to the Higher Secondary School Certificate by Inter Board Committee of Chairman, Government of Pakistan, Ministry of Education, Islamabad but they are not being allowed to appear in the B.A (Bachelor of Arts), examination by the Baha-ud-Din Zikriya University, Multan. Further states that course of Field Assistants have been up-graded and renamed as Diploma of Agriculture Sciences (DAS) and now the duration of this course is three years and the institution is affiliated with Agricultural University, Faisalabad and examination of this course is being conducted by the afore-mentioned university; that two years post matric diploma of Field Assistant has been declared equivalent to Higher Secondary School Certificate (Agriculture group after passing English, Urdu and Pak Studies from any Board of Intermediate and Secondary Education in Pakistan or Allama Iqbal Open University); further states that non-acceptance of diploma of Field Assistant two years course is contrary to the decision taken by the IBCC and that Baha-ud-Din Zikriya University has issued Letter No.Acad 2232 dated 13-3-2008 by which they have set condition for the acceptance or otherwise of the students in B.A. By virtue of this letter, they have foreclosed the admission of diploma-holders to B.A. Petitioner states that Field Assistant Diploma Holders has already met the condition of Passing of English, Urdu and Pakistan Studies but in spite of that respondent No.1 has disallowed admission to them contrary to the decision of IBCC.

2. Report and parawise comments were called for and have been filed by the respondents.

3. Arguments heard. Record perused.

4. The IBCC in its order dated 15-3-2008 has informed the petitioner as under:- "This is to inform that as per IBCC Rules Diploma of Field Assistant awarded by University of Agriculture, Faisalabad or an Institute affiliated with it is equivalent to Higher Secondary School Certificate (Agriculture Group), subject to passing English, Urdu and Pakistan Studies at HSSC level from any Board of Intermediate and Secondary Education in Pakistan or Allama Iqbal Open University."

5. It is, thus, clear that the Diploma of Field Assistants awarded by the University of Agriculture, Faisalabad or any of the Institute affiliated with it is equivalent to Higher Secondary School Certificate (Agriculture Group), subject to passing English, Urdu and Pakistan Studies at HSSC level from any Board of Intermediate and Secondary Education in Pakistan or Allama Iqbal Open University.

6. Learned counsel for the petitioner is unable to point out any illegality in the impugned decision of Baha-ud-Din Zakriya, University, Multan which is in conformity with the policy framed by the IBCC. This petition being devoid of any force is dismissed. S.A.K. /Z-12/L Petition dismissed.
